Only a cursor is displayed when "systemctl isolate multi-user.target" is run from GNOME Desktop session
Issue
When "systemctl isolate multi-user.target" is run from GNOME Desktop session, only a cursor is displayed, and a bash prompt is not displayed.
Environment
- Red Hat Enterprise Linux 8
- gdm-3.28.3-9.el8
